Join us as we discover vibrant new worlds, surprising characters, breathtaking landscapes, and unknown traditions in this animation shorts package. Vote for your favourite short film at the end of the screening.

All short films are either non-dialogue, in English or with easy-to-follow English subtitles.

Fallin’ (Dir: Carlos Navarro, Spain, 2024)

Awakening in a season not its own, the Winter Spirit must learn to discover beauty in the unfamiliar, confronting personal biases and embracing the ever-changing cycle.

The Legend of the Hummingbird (Dir: Morgan Devos, France, 2025)

A fire breaks out in the Amazon rainforest, and frightened animals leave their habitat to take refuge on the other bank. Only a little hummingbird persists in fighting the fire when he spots a sloth, and its young family trapped in the flames.

Desert Critter (Dir: Lina Walde, Germany, 2023)

The desert critter casts the shadow of a palm tree. No other animal has such an annoying shadow. Can the animal exchange the shadow for another? A story about the friendship of two animals that stay together regardless of their species and origin.

The Bear and the Bird (Dir: Marie Caudry, France, 2023)

In the North, winter is approaching. Bear thinks of her friend Bird who migrated south. Instead of hibernating like she does every year, she decides to travel the world to join him.

Homework (Dir: Nacho Arjona, Spain, 2024)

The imaginative adventures of a pencil and its friends, using their unique abilities to help each other in unexpected situations, inside of the school where all of them live.

Atomic Chicken (Dir: Thibault Ermeneux, Lucie Lyfoung, Soléne Polet, France, 2023)

The daily life of the chicken coop has undergone earth-shaking changes!

Cinemagic ‘On the Pulse’, is an exciting month-long programme of screenings, film education events, talks and workshops on the short film genre and short form storytelling. We have programmed a season of the very best international short films, classic heritage shorts and cartoons, as well as showcasing short films made by local young filmmakers.

Cinemagic 'On the Pulse' is funded by the Department for Communities through Northern Ireland Screen.
